Digiscoping with K100D - Awesome results
Here are some preliminary results hand held against the eyepiece with my new pentax K100D and my Pentax PF-80-ED scope.
The first picture is a first year Karoo Thrush (turdus smithi) and the second is a Common Myna (Acridotheres tristis) both photographed in my garden. |

I know these are not birds but this was a tough test I devised for testing the SR (shake reduction). - HAD HELD AT NIGHT WITH NO FLASH AND NO TRIPOD!!
Fountain1 has SR off, Fountain 2 and 3 have SR on. Merry-Go-Round1 has SR off, merry-go-round2 has SR on. The difference is obvious and I was shooting at between 1/2 and 1/4 of a second HANDHELD!!! |
